Petrophysics-Python-Series

This series of Jupyter Notebooks take you through various aspects of working with Python and Petrophysical data. A number of the notebooks are accompanied by either a Blog Post or a Medium article. You can find the full list on my website at: http://andymcdonald.scot/python-and-petrophysics

Series Contents:

  1. Loading and Displaying Well Data - Medium Link
  2. Displaying a Well Plot with matplotlib
  3. Displaying histograms and crossplots
  4. Displaying core data and deriving a regression
  5. Petrophysical Calculations
  6. Displaying Formations on Log Plots
  7. Working with LASIO
  8. Curve Normalization - Medium Link
  9. Visualising Data Coverage - Multi Well - Medium Link
  10. Exploratory Data Analysis with Well Log Data - Medium Link
  11. Deriving a Porosity - Permeability Relationship - Medium Link
  12. Enhancing Log Plots With Plot Fills - Medium Link
  13. Displaying LWD Image Data - Medium Link
  14. Displaying Lithology Data on a Well Log Plot Using Python Medium Link
  15. Loading Multiple LAS Files Medium Link
  16. Adding Formation Data to a Log Plot Medium Link

Data Sets Used

Data for each workbook can be found with this repo's Data sub folder.

All data has been obtained from publicly accessible data repositories. Details for the origins of each file is presented below.

Equinor Volve Dataset

  • 15_9-19.csv
  • 15_9-19A-CORE.csv
  • 15-9-19_SR_COMP.LAS
  • VolveWells.csv

Information on the Volve dataset can be found at: https://www.equinor.com/en/what-we-do/norwegian-continental-shelf-platforms/volve.html

NLOG - Netherlands Well Log and Data Repository

  • L0509WellData.csv
  • L0509_comp.las
  • P11-A-02_Composite_MEM_Image_NF.las
  • P11-A-02_SURV.csv

Dutch offshore and onshore well data can be accessed from: https://nlog.nl/en

Force 2020 XEEK

  • xeek_train_subset.csv

Data was provided by the FORCE Machine Learning competition with well logs and seismic 2020โ€
Bormann P., Aursand P., Dilib F., Dischington P., Manral S. 2020. 2020 FORCE Machine Learning Contest. https://github.com/bolgebrygg/Force-2020-Machine-Learning-competition
